Overview

The Flume Gorge Food Court is the park’s easy, no-fuss place to refuel without leaving the action. It sits inside the Gilman Visitor Center at the start/finish of the Flume Gorge loop, and the attached deck has legit mountain views—exactly what you want with a post-hike snack.

What’s on the menu

Expect classic cafeteria fare done for hikers and families: light breakfast items, soups, sandwiches, chicken fingers, fries, snacks, and ice cream. There’s also grab‑and‑go if you’re hustling to a timed entry or just finished the loop and want something quick.

Hours and season

The Visitor Center is typically open 9 AM–5 PM during the regular season (May 9–Oct 26). The food court follows those hours, with the kitchen serving hot food roughly 11 AM–4 PM. If you’re cutting it close to closing, plan on cold/grab‑and‑go options.

Where it is and why it’s handy

Because it’s inside the Visitor Center, you can hit restrooms, the gift shop, and tickets in the same stop. It’s perfect for a simple breakfast before the 2‑mile Flume loop or an easy lunch after—no extra driving needed.

Best time to visit

Midday is the busiest at the Visitor Center, especially around lunch. Aim for late morning before 11 AM or after 2 PM for shorter lines and a better shot at a deck table. Sunny days make that deck the hot commodity.

Bottom line

This is a convenience play: basic, reliable trail fuel with a surprisingly nice view. Go for speed and location, not a destination meal.
